  • I live here and planning to attend. Have not been to concert at Rupp but have seen a couple basketball games which have been a blast. Pizza place called Pies and Pints right across the street. New restaurant called HopCat which has a tremendous beer selection. You'll also be able to find bourbon without a problem. There is a nice Hilton downtown right near the arena which also has a restaurant called Bigg Blue Martini. Haven't had food but drinks before ball game since its so close to arena. Also, there is a restaurant called Saul Good within walking distance of both Hilton and arena which has good food and beverage options. The Hyatt is connected to Rupp so obviously a nice choice due to minimal travel. Interested in some good craft beer, there is one about 5 minutes from arena called Blue Stallion Brewing Co.

    One thing I just realized.

    Keeneland is in session during the time this concert is taking place.

    I know everyone will think it's just horse racing, but trust me on this, you DO NOT WANT TO MISS a trip to Keeneland during the spring meet. It is an experience like no other.

    Race days are Wednesday through Sunday, so either go down early and attend Keeneland on Sunday or go there the day after the show.

    The scenery is incredible (both natural scenery and people scenery) and you can even tailgate outside in the parking areas.

    On Trip Advisor, it has 5 stars and is rated the #1 thing to do in Lexington. It's only open for racing just a few weeks out of the year.
